J'ai maintenant la même question avec le titre ci-dessus mais je n'ai pas encore trouvé la bonne réponse. J'ai eu l'erreur:
/Users/nle/Library/Developer/Xcode/DerivedData/TestMoboSDK-Client-cgodalyxmwqzynaxfbbewrooymnq/Build/Intermediates/TestMoboSDK-Client.build/Debug-iphonesimulator/TestMoboSDK-Client.build/Objects-normal/x86_64/MoboSDK.o
/Users/nle/Library/Developer/Xcode/DerivedData/TestMoboSDK-Client-cgodalyxmwqzynaxfbbewrooymnq/Build/Products/Debug-iphonesimulator/libMoboSDK.a(MoboSDK.o)
duplicate symbol _OBJC_METACLASS_$_MoboSDK in:
/Users/nle/Library/Developer/Xcode/DerivedData/TestMoboSDK-Client-cgodalyxmwqzynaxfbbewrooymnq/Build/Intermediates/TestMoboSDK-Client.build/Debug-iphonesimulator/TestMoboSDK-Client.build/Objects-normal/x86_64/MoboSDK.o
/Users/nle/Library/Developer/Xcode/DerivedData/TestMoboSDK-Client-cgodalyxmwqzynaxfbbewrooymnq/Build/Products/Debug-iphonesimulator/libMoboSDK.a(MoboSDK.o)
ld: 75 duplicate symbols for architecture x86_64
clang: error: linker command failed with exit code 1 (use -v to see invocation)
Toute aide est appréciée.
Enfin, je trouve la raison de cette erreur, car j'ai ajouté -ObjC
à la Other Linker Flags
. Après avoir supprimé cette valeur, je peux créer mon projet avec succès, mais je ne sais pas pourquoi. Quelqu'un peut-il expliquer cela?
GoogleConversionTrackingSDK-iOS-3.0
à mon projet.Avant cela, cela fonctionne bien.J'ai également essayé de le supprimer, mais l'erreur persiste.
#include
« d ou#import
» d quelque chose (probablement le MoboSDK, quelle qu'elle soit) plus d'une fois.